This expansive loft in the historic Morse Building is waiting to welcome you home.

At almost 2,000 square feet, with 11' ceilings, exposed brick, solid hardwood floors throughout, and an abundance of storage space, it is currently configured as a 1 bedroom, 2 bathroom residence with a spacious home office/guest room complete with a Murphy bed. A wall of oversized windows facing west offers views of the architecturally ornate neighboring facades, as well as a striking direct view of the iconic Woolworth Building.

The kitchen features custom pearwood cabinetry, sleek black granite countertops and backsplash, a suite of complementary black GE Profile appliances, and a full size Eurocave wine fridge. Luxuriate in the master bath's huge steam shower outfitted with dual showerheads plus a center rain shower, and lined with soothing sea green glass tiles. There is a double sink vanity, and a Toto toilet. The 2nd bath features a deep soaking tub, a custom sink basin, and is clad in white tumbled marble.

The convenient FiDi location is just south of City Hall Park, close to all major train lines at Fulton Center, nearby great neighborhood restaurants, and close to the Oculus, Brookfield Place and Westfield World Trade Center. For more shopping, dining and entertainment, head west into Tribeca, north into Soho, east towards the Seaport and south towards the heart of the Financial District.

The Morse Building was once the tallest building in New York. Built in 1879 by two nephews of Samuel F. B. Morse, inventor of the telegraph, the facade features Romanesque style arches with contrasting red and black brick above the windows. An early tenant was the American Vitagraph Company, who created a motion picture studio on the roof. Converted to a cooperative in 1980, it was designated a New York City Landmark in 2006. The lobby maintains its beautiful mosaic wall murals, there are only 3 lofts per floor, and there's a lushly planted common roof deck with panoramic downtown views.
